Alamere Falls is an incredibly popular hiking destination in Point Reyes National Seashore's Phillip Burton … There is NO park-sanctioned "Alamere Falls Trail." Many social media posts, websites, and guide books reference an "Alamere Falls Trail" (sometimes referred to as a "shortcut"). This is NOT a maintained trail, and poses many hazards to off-trail hikers—crumbling and eroding cliffs and lots of poison oak. Visitors who use this unmaintained ...

The easiest way to get to Alamere Falls without using the unofficial shortcut is to continue up the Coast Trail for 1.5 miles to Wildcat Camp, then walk down the beach 1.3 miles to Alamere Falls. Geo-coordinates: 37.9537, -122.7835. Alamere Falls is a beautiful waterfall deep within the Phillip Burton Wilderness. The falls are a dramatic sight as water cascades over a ~40-foot-tall (~12 m) cliff onto the south end of Wildcat Beach. Coordinates: 37°57′13.4″N 122°47′00.2″W. Alamere Falls is a waterfall in Point Reyes National Seashore, Marin County, California.
